METHOD OF CREATING INDUSTRIAL STREPTOMYCES WITH CAPABILITY TO GROW ON CELLULOSIC POLYSACCHARIDE SUBSTRATES

A heterologous gene cassette useful for creating Streptomyces species with enhanced capability of growing on a cellulosic polysaccharide substrate, wherein the cassette comprises at least two members of the following categories: a) a GH6 gene, b) an AA10 gene, c) a GH48 gene, d) a GH5 gene and e) either (i) a GH9 gene, (ii) a GH9 gene and a GH12 gene, or (iii) a GH12 gene is disclosed.

Gene targets for improved enzyme production in fungi

Fungi that are genetically inactivated for the mstC gene (or a homolog thereof) are provided, which can also be genetically modified to increase production of heterologous proteins from a glucoamylase promoter. Methods of using these fungi, for example to degrade a biomass, are also provided.
